From 46cfe8eee285cde465b420637507884551f5d7ca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: "Jason A. Donenfeld" Date: Fri, 4 Jun 2021 17:17:35 +0200 Subject: wireguard: allowedips: initialize list head in selftest The randomized trie tests weren't initializing the dummy peer list head, resulting in a NULL pointer dereference when used. Fix this by initializing it in the randomized trie test, just like we do for the static unit test. While we're at it, all of the other strings like this have the word "self-test", so add it to the missing place here.
